You might think that after winning 'American Idol' in 2002, Kelly Clarkson would have throngs of guys lined up on her doorstep. Instead, the singer describes her past Christmases as mistletoe-free, adding that she was "pathetically alone" before meeting hubby Brandon Blackstock.

"I was single for almost seven years," Clarkson says, opening up to Parade. "Every Christmas, it was like, ‘Seriously, I’m still pathetically alone? Awesome. I’m still telling people I’m okay with it? I’m not.'"

"I only had like three boyfriends my whole life before Brandon, and two of them were good, just not a good fit," the star adds. "I only had one real stinker [who] I wrote [music about] and made a lot of money off of."

Although her time spent single sounds rather difficult, when Clarkson met Blackstock, she just knew he was the one she wanted to be with -- after all, seven years gives you a lot of time to think about qualities you want and don't! "[When I started dating Brandon], in my head, I was like, 'I'm already married to you!'" she admits. "My life did a 180 -- in the most awesome way."

Truly, Clarkson's life looks drastically different from even a few months ago. The 'Tie It Up' singer got hitched to Blackstock and recently announced a baby on the way (and she's sure it's a girl). This Christmas, she won't be alone at all; she has her little family (with one on the way) to celebrate with.
